AMD

Athlon II X2 240e

The Athlon II X2 240e is manufactured by AMD. It was released in 20 October 2009 (16 years ago). It is based on the Regor (2009−2013) architecture. It features 2 cores and 2 threads. Base frequency is 2.8 GHz, with boost up to 2.8 GHz. L3 cache: 0 kB. L2 cache: 1 MB. Built on 45 nm process technology. Socket: AM3. Thermal design power (TDP): 45 Watt. Memory support: DDR3. Passmark benchmark score: 1,007 points. Launch price was $35.

Intel

Core 2 Duo E8135

The Core 2 Duo E8135 is manufactured by Intel. It was released in 2008-01-01. It is based on the Penryn (2008−2011) architecture. It features 2 cores and 2 threads. Base frequency is 2.667 GHz, with boost up to 0.67 GHz. L2 cache: 6 MB (total). Built on 45 nm process technology. Socket: P. Thermal design power (TDP): 44 Watt. Memory support: DDR2, DDR3. Passmark benchmark score: 1,020 points. Launch price was $249.
